Transaction 11580a613f08bb099a5153cb9c805076358a16b05f58a4bb2f5cdf2bd2a620ec

1 Input
2 Outputs
  • 11580a613f08bb099a5153cb9c805076358a16b05f58a4bb2f5cdf2bd2a620ec:0
  • value  20000000
    address  1HmZ3UpW9KCqbkz8xdXB53b1qWNptuMqF
  • 11580a613f08bb099a5153cb9c805076358a16b05f58a4bb2f5cdf2bd2a620ec:1
  • value  72091312
    address  3QrzwH7m99aLyTKPZALi9nPMR1DqmBLHhg